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8689 0494 91646836222
13 00
13 00
638065937 2825 797746392
All about undefined
Interested in learning more?
13 00
638065937 2825 797746392
See more
9354893596 279461082
62 53473831 569 638 64
See more
524232 155682185 66254
28828 3191 2857
See more